Output 34a75d7565393673a91afe6bc1f9eb19ca436e08b98049f671d8980f590cb4af:0

value
510096
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9aefe34204551a8deb95cc4064166f001c581965 OP_EQUAL
address
3FpFMn2Fh7ZvCyWxCw94bFn2RA3AQ2DFJW
transaction
34a75d7565393673a91afe6bc1f9eb19ca436e08b98049f671d8980f590cb4af
spent
true